#2D548B Color
#2D548B is rgb(45, 84, 139) in RGB, hsl(215, 51%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(68%, 40%, 0%, 45%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is B'dazzled Blue (#2E5894),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.26.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#2D548B Channel Values
How #2D548B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 45 · G 84 · B 139 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 215° · S 51%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 215° · S 68% · V 55%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 68% · M 40% · Y 0% · K 45%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 7.63:1 vs white · 2.75: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#2D548B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#2D548B?
#2D548B is a dark blue — rgb(45, 84, 139) in RGB and hsl(215, 51%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is B'dazzled Blue (#2E5894),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.26.
What is the RGB value of #2D548B?
#2D548B is rgb(45, 84, 139) — red 45, green 84, and blue 139 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#2D548B?
#2D548B converts to approximately cmyk(68%, 40%, 0%, 45%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#2D548B be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#2D548B scores 7.63:1 against white and 2.75: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#2D548B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#2D548B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is steelblue (#4682B4) at a CIE76 distance of 19.3, which is visibly different.
